Chinese, Japanese PMs Hold Talks in Tokyo
Visiting Chinese Premier
Zhu Rongji
and
Japan
ese Prime Minister Yoshiro Mori began talks on Friday morning to discuss ways to promote friendly and cooperative relations.
The meeting was held at the Japanese prime minister's official residence in Tokyo.
Zhu arrived here Thursday for a six-day official visit to Japan.
